Ele’s recent work has taken inspiration from the ocean, nature and the natural world whilst seeking to make images that have a feeling of light and space, the landscape and the sea, without being a literal representation.
Living on the coast in Brighton has had a definite influence, with much of the new work conveying the openness and feel of space, depth and water.
An imaginary floating world is created with hidden spaces, things half-shown and suggested inviting the viewer to find and interpret their own symbols in an ambiguous visual field. Clouds, reflections, elements of landscape and the coast have all been observed. Only when a balance and integration is achieved does Ele feel that the painting is finished.
I like to think of paintings as “visual poems”. This sensual world is one to be absorbed, felt, and enjoyed.
Ele Pack received her degree from Loughborough College of Art. She now lives and works in Brighton. She has exhibited her paintings both nationally, and internationally. Her work has been exhibited by various UK galleries, and overseas in Germany, Sweden and the US.
Her work has also been published as fine art prints by Rosenstiels publishers, and The Art Group. She is represented by Josie Eastwood Fine Art, ArtDog London for international & UK art fairs, and Cornwall Contemporary in Penzance. She has work in private collections in Canada, the US and Europe.
